Wedding Crashers 2 confirmed to be in development

After “Wedding Crashers” grossed $285 million worldwide in 2005, it was only a matter of time before a sequel was going to be on the cards.

Confirmed by Isla Fisher on the Today Show, the actress mentioned that Vince Vaughn had spoken to her at a party and told her that a sequel was in the works. The orignal film was generally well received and starred Owen Wilson, Vince Vaughn, Rachel McAdams, Isla Fisher and Christopher Walken.

With a 75% rating from critics on Rotten Tomatoes, the film was widely ‘loved’ by audiences for being highly entertaining and also featured a cameo with Will Ferrel. There are few details available about where the storyline will go in the upcoming sequel but after 10 years the original R-rated comedy sets the bar high for a follow-up movie at a time where audiences are tired of remakes and franchises.
